
Mango (Dragonite) (M) @ Lum Berry
Ability: Multiscale
EVs: 252 Atk / 4 SpD / 252 Spe
Jolly Nature
- Dragon Dance
- Outrage
- Earthquake
- ExtremeSpeed
The star of the team - Mango the Dragonite. My absolute favourite Pokemon I just had to base a team around. If only he had a Mega. Anyway, his main function here is Physical Sweeper, setting up a Ddance and ruining most opposition with EQ and Outrage (once those pesky fairies have been eliminated). Espeed is awesome for revenge kills, and the Lum Berry gives Mango a one-time get out of burn/confusion free card so he can continue sweeping. Of course, we don't want any stealth rocks or spikes breaking that beautiful Multiscale ability, so we have a spinner in the form of Starmie.

Checkmate (Bisharp) (M) @ Life Orb
Ability: Defiant
EVs: 252 Atk / 4 Def / 252 Spe
Jolly Nature
- Iron Head
- Knock Off
- Sucker Punch
- Low Kick
Fairies are a huge threat to Dragonite, so in comes Bisharp with Iron Head. That's really his main purpose, but he comes with some other benefits too. Knock Off is almost essential to most teams now and Bisharp hits really hard with it. Sucker Punch is there for priority which can really help him clean up late-game especially if he has a Defiant boost. Low Kick is there as opposed to Swords Dance because I have no fighting coverage elsewhere.

Pretty Boy (Clefable) (M) @ Leftovers
Ability: Unaware
EVs: 252 HP / 252 Def / 4 SpD
Bold Nature
IVs: 0 Atk
- Moonblast
- Wish
- Stealth Rock
- Heal Bell
The new cleric of the team. Clefable is here to replace Sylveon as he gets the benefit of Stealth Rocks (something my team really needed, again, thanks Lunistrius), while still maintaining the healing capabilities that really help keep my team on their feet. Not to mention, it counters the dragons that can threaten Dragonite. Unaware is nice for general reasons. Moonblast = obligatory stab. Heal Bell is essential for removing any crippling status conditions that could hinder Dragonite and any other team members. Wish is obvious.
